Tourist Guide Neath

Neath can be mentioned as a town as well as community located in ‘Neath Port Tabot, Wales, UK’s’ principal area. An interesting fact is that it stands on river which bears the same name.

This place, i.e. Neath has been served by ‘South Wales Main Line’ at ‘Neath Railway Station’ in center of town so far. Services go on to have operated to Cardiff Central, Bristol Parkway, Newport, Bridgend, and ‘London Paddington’ on the eastern side; and ‘Swansea’, West Wales, and Carmarthen on the western side.

Bus station is located at ‘Victoria Gardens’, adjoining railway station. Victoria Gardens is the place from which ‘First Cymru’ goes on to have provided inter-urban services on the direct basis to adjoining Port Talbot and Swansea. ‘A465’ executes the task of skirting Neath towards north-east; thereby having provided a ‘link’ to M4.

The population as of 2001 census was 45898.
